The Department of Biology in the College of Arts and Sciences at North Central College (NCC) invites applications from broadly trained cell and molecular biologist for a tenure-track position to begin Fall 2027. Appointment at the rank of assistant professor is likely, but qualified candidates may be considered for a higher rank. Teaching responsibilities will include an advanced course in molecular biology, a basic cell biology course, and introductory and capstone courses in our innovative research-focused curriculum.

About NCC:
Founded in 1861, North Central College is a selective, comprehensive liberal arts institution of about 3000 students, located 28 miles west of Chicago in Naperville. The College is in a period of growth with the addition of a $60 million Science Center (2017), and a new Health Sciences and Engineering building (2020). North Central College is within walking distance of the Naperville Metra station and is next to downtown Naperville. The Naperville area is home to many excellent school districts and Naperville, IL has been ranked as one of the best places to live by Money magazine.
